PIN Code 530044 – Visakhapatanam, Andhra Pradesh

We found a total of 5 post offices linked with the postal code 530044. This PIN Code is associated with Visakhapatanam district of Andhra Pradesh in India. The first digit of ZIP Code 530044 i.e. 5 represents the region Andhra Pradesh, the second digit 3 denotes the sub-region Visakhapatnam Region and the third digit 0 indicates the sorting-district Visakhapatanam.

What is a DIGIPIN?

DIGIPIN is India Post's free Digital PIN: a 10-character code that pinpoints any location to a ~4-metre square. Find the DIGIPIN of your current location, or decode a DIGIPIN to see it on the map.
